[0036] The IBC identity authentication method based on digital fingerprint random secret value of the present invention is based on fingerprint feature vector and random secret value analysis method for identity authentication, and the process is divided into two parts: user registration and user identity verification.

[0037] The user registration process of IBC identity authentication based on digital fingerprint random password value includes: 1. The user's private key is jointly generated by the user ID, password PW, and the system master key generated by the PKG server. Abstract

The invention discloses a random secret value IBC identity authentication method based on a digital fingerprint. The random secret value IBC identity authentication method based on the digital fingerprint comprises the steps that (1) a user private key is jointly generated according to a user ID, a password PW and a system main secret key generated by a PKG server, digital fingerprint information of the user is encrypted, and user identity mark information is generated; (2) the PKG server generates a user identity credential according to the user ID, the password PW, a fingerprint feature ciphertext and a user identity credential time limit and sends and stores the user identity credential to a user authentication server; (3) the user authentication server deduces the authenticity of the user identity mark information according to stored user identity credential information and a fingerprint feature threshold value. The random secret value IBC identity authentication method based on the digital fingerprint has good authentication, privacy and non-repudiation performance, and is suitable for identity authentication among entities in a monitoring system.
